LAKE COUNTY, Calif. – The Lake County Board of Supervisors will help kick off a 14-week countywide physical activity challenge during their regular meeting on Tuesday, Jan. 14.
The proclamation will be presented at 9:10 a.m. in the board chambers on the first floor of the Lake County Courthouse, 255 N. Forbes S., Lakeport.
Move More 20+14 ( http://movemore2014.org ) is a first-time endeavor to engage Lake County residents with adding more physical activity into their daily routine.
The challenge takes advantage of the 2014 New Year as an ideal time for folks to consider how they can get 20 minutes or more of moderate physical activity daily for the next 14 weeks.
It only takes a few weeks to begin a positive habit, therefore participation in 14 weeks of this effort will be a fun way to establish a healthy habit that can continue indefinitely.
Regular physical activity has more positive benefits than nearly any other single choice one can make.
It’s an excellent way to feel better physically, mentally and emotionally by increasing energy levels, helping to maintain weight, calming stress, elevating mood and emotional well-being, improving sleep patterns and preventing a number of chronic health conditions from heart disease to diabetes, and various cancers – to name only a few.
It’s really not too difficult to add 20 minutes of activity to your day. You don’t have to get it all at once – climbing the stairs, walking around the block, taking a walk during lunch break at work, doing a few calisthenics at your workstation, parking your car a distance away from the store in the parking lot, taking a family bike ride – it all adds up.
The endeavor is one way to encourage building physical activity into daily routines in whatever way works for you. Small steps reap big rewards.

Move More 20+14 is a collaborative activity across several organizations and stakeholders who are participating in a Community Transformation Grant awarded to St. Helena Hospital Clear Lake by the National Centers of Disease Control as a means to reduce chronic disease and lift Lake County from its poor overall health ranking.
